Lucosky Brookman LLP Represents Quantum Computing Inc. in $750 Million Oversubscribed Private Placement
Quantum Computing Inc. (Nasdaq: QUBT) (“QCi” or the “Company”), an innovative, integrated photonics and quantum optics technology company, announced that it has entered into securities purchase agreements with institutional investors for an oversubscribed private placement of approximately $750 million, priced at-the-market under Nasdaq rules.
Titan Partners Group, a division of American Capital Partners, acted as the sole placement agent for the offering. Lucosky Brookman LLP served as legal counsel to Quantum Computing Inc. in connection with the transaction.
The Company intends to use the net proceeds from the private placement to fully fund commercialization efforts, pursue strategic acquisitions, establish volume production capabilities, expand its sales and engineering teams, and for working capital and general corporate purposes.
With this financing, QCi has now raised approximately $1.64 billion since November 2024, positioning the Company with one of the strongest balance sheets among publicly traded quantum computing companies.
This additional capital will support QCi’s continued transition from a quantum technology innovator to a leading hardware manufacturer.
